To attach a Stickies note to a specific Window the Window must be open on the desktop.

Right click the note title. On the menu that opens left click "Attach". The window that opens will have a list of the available windows to attach the note to. Check "Only if visible" if you do not want the note visible when the window is minimized.

Make your choice by left clicking on the window name in the list. Click "OK".
